Defending champions Australia suffered a major blow ahead of the knockout stage of the Women's Twenty20 World Cup when all-rounder Ellyse Perry was ruled out of the remainder of the tournament on Tuesday. The twice ICC women's cricketer of the year hobbled off the field in tears after suffering a right hamstring injury during Monday's four-run victory over New Zealand that sealed a place in the semi-finals for the hosts.

With Doordarshan opting out of the simultaneous coverage of the India-South Africa three-test match series, sports channel Neo Sports the exclusive telecast rights holder for the series hopes to rake in Rs 70 crore in advertising revenue. Neo Sports has eight on-air sponsors (two co-sponsors and six associate sponsors). Coca-Cola, Airtel, Hero Honda, Pidilite and Asian Paints are putting about Rs 26-28 crore, while the remaining amount will come from spot selling.
